Frequently asked questions

Is Cozy Caribbean Beachfront House (Pet & Kid Friendly) pet-friendly?

Yes, pets are allowed at this property.

What time is check-in at Cozy Caribbean Beachfront House (Pet & Kid Friendly)?

Check-in begins at 3:00 PM.

What time is check-out at Cozy Caribbean Beachfront House (Pet & Kid Friendly)?

Checkout is at 11:00 AM.

Where is Cozy Caribbean Beachfront House (Pet & Kid Friendly) located?

Situated on the beach, this holiday home is 0.9 mi (1.5 km) from Black Beach and within 3 miles (5 km) of Talamanca Family Art and Playa Cocles. Refugio Nacional de Vida Silvestre Gandoca-Manzanillo is 3 mi (4.8 km) away.

Location!
It’s pretty hard to beat the location, a minute walk to the black sand beach right in front, which was never crowded. When we were there swimming wasn’t possible, but playing in the surf was really fun. It’s just a short bike ride to town, about a mile. The yard is full of flowers and offered us many cool wildlife sightings. Nearby there is a fun 2 mile hike or bike to a bird filled river that empties into the sea. The listing photos should be updated as they do not reflect the current condition of the house. The house is in need of maintenance. The kitchen was a challenge, and needs several upgrades. The paved street between the house and the beach is very noisy, but the road noise lessens at night. However, dogs bark and roosters crow then. We would highly recommend Cahuita National Park, Punta Uva, the Jaguar Rescue Center, the chocolate tour at Caribeans, and the Puerto Viejo Bike shop for rentals, and Degustibus Bakery.
